## The End of an Era: NVIDIA Set to Cease Production of the Beloved GeForce RTX 3060 GPU
NVIDIA’s GeForce RTX 3060, a GPU that has enjoyed immense popularity among gamers and enthusiasts alike, is reportedly approaching the end of its production run. Sources indicate that as NVIDIA shifts focus to the upcoming RTX 4060 series, the availability of the RTX 3060 is expected to dwindle, marking the end of this cherished graphics card’s journey.
### An Influential Passageway in Gaming Hardware
The GeForce RTX 3060 is part of NVIDIA’s acclaimed Ampere series and has earned its reputation as one of the company’s best GPUs. Recent industry announcements reveal NVIDIA’s intent to discontinue the RTX 3060, urging its partners to place their final orders. This last batch will signal the final opportunity for Add-In Board (AIB) partners to stock up on the RTX 3060, leading to the gradual disappearance of the GPU from the production lines.
Although the precise details regarding which editions—the 8 GB or the 12 GB—will cease production were not explicitly mentioned, the reliance on the same GA106 GPU die suggests that both may see their conclusion around the same timeframe. AIBs have been advised to obtain the remaining GPU stocks, with the last shipments expected to be delivered to various partners in the coming months.

### A Legacy of Popularity
Despite the looming halt in production, the RTX 3060’s presence remains strong. It is not only a top seller in retail spaces but also retains a significant user base on gaming platforms, as evidenced by its ranking in the Steam Hardware Survey of July. The survey showed a 0.22% increase in user ownership of the 3060, reaching a milestone of 5.71% of participants. These statistics, while not exhaustive due to varying participation levels in the survey, still showcase the GPU’s dominance in the market, outperforming its siblings and competitors.
### A Reigning Champion in Sales
Retail giants like Amazon and Newegg have reported that models of the RTX 3060, specifically the 12GB versions, have been leading their sales charts. Notably, models from MSI have been highlighted as best sellers, further emphasizing the RTX 3060’s status as the preferred choice for a large portion of the gaming community, even when compared to the next-generation RTX 4060.
